Monk's Rock is shown as a islet on the public map of Pembrokeshire. The saved point is the map point or the centre of its mapped shape.
Monk's Rock is a small islet located off the coast of Pembrokeshire, Wales, and is notable for its historical association with monastic activity in the region. Though no permanent population lived there, it may have been used by hermitic monks or as a waypoint for religious travelers in the medieval period.
